How to “borrow” seeds

Browse the seed collection onsite at the SMFA Library and bring the seeds you’d like to use to the circulation desk. We won’t check them out to your library account, but we’ll note what you take so our inventory is up to date.

If you’re based on the Tufts Medford campus, you can browse the online seed catalog here and use this form to request seeds. We’ll send them to the Tisch Library and you’ll receive an email when they’re available to pick up.

How to “return” seeds

Returning seeds is not required to use the seed library. If you have leftover seeds, you can give them to the library for someone else to use. We also encourage you to save seeds from the plants you grow and “return” them to our collection.

See below for information about how to save seeds. Please use this form for each type of seed you donate or return, or fill out a paper form at the SMFA Library. To return seeds from the Medford campus, please contact Abby Geluso at Tisch Library.

About

The Seed Library at the SMFA Library is a collection of seeds available to members of the SMFA and Tufts communities and other SMFA Library users.

The Seed Library is an extension of the SMFA Garden project, which was funded by the 2020 Tufts Green Fund.
